Calorie Requirements

We calculate your daily calorie needs using the Mifflin-St Jeor equation, which is considered the most accurate formula for estimating basal metabolic rate (BMR).

The Formula:

For men:

BMR = (10 × weight in kg) + (6.25 × height in cm) - (5 × age) + 5

For women:

BMR = (10 × weight in kg) + (6.25 × height in cm) - (5 × age) - 161

This base rate is then adjusted by your activity level to determine your total daily energy expenditure (TDEE).

Macronutrient Balance

We recommend balanced macronutrient distributions based on your goals, but allow for customization to fit your dietary preferences.

Protein 30% 4 kcal/g
Carbs 45% 4 kcal/g
Fats 25% 9 kcal/g

These ratios are adjusted based on your fitness goals: higher protein for muscle building, more carbs for endurance activities, and balanced fat intake for hormone health.

Water Intake

Your hydration needs are calculated based on your weight, activity level, and climate considerations.

Base Formula:

Daily water (oz) = Body weight (lbs) × 0.5 to 0.67

We then adjust for exercise (adding 16-24 oz per hour of activity), climate (more in hot weather), and other factors like altitude and pregnancy.

Micronutrient Tracking

We track essential vitamins and minerals based on Dietary Reference Intakes (DRIs) established by health authorities.

Key Micronutrients:

  • • Vitamin A
  • • Vitamin C
  • • Vitamin D
  • • Calcium
  • • Iron
  • • Potassium
  • • Magnesium
  • • Zinc

Our app automatically calculates your intake percentages based on age, gender, and other personal factors to ensure you're meeting your needs.
